About Basati Taberna Rock bar

Basati Taberna Rock bar is a fiercely authentic rock & metal pub in San Sebastián's Parte Vieja, where curated music and exceptional beer selection define the experience. The bar has earned a 4.9-star rating across 170 reviews, with staff consistently praised for attentiveness, warmth, and genuine care—bartenders actively engage with guests, remembering requests and crafting recommendations with precision. The imported beer roster spans Belgian selections and rare finds like draught cherry beer, sourced with deliberation. The space itself maintains an immaculate, welcoming rock-bar aesthetic that feels lived-in rather than contrived. Regulars and first-time visitors alike report feeling immediately at home; the team's bilingual ease and hospitality transform a casual drink into a memorable encounter. Open late into the morning, it functions as both a pre-night anchor and a final stop for those seeking genuine connection over commercial polish.
